项目技术管理流程主要包含以下几个部分:需求分析、系统设计、编码实现、系统测试和系统维护。其中,需求分析是项目技术管理流程的第一步,也是非常关键的一步。在这一步中,项目经理和技术团队需要深入理解客户的需求,梳理出项目的技术需求,并将这些需求转化为实际的项目任务。这一步的工作涉及到需求调研、需求分析、需求规划以及需求文档的编写等多个环节。
一、需求分析
需求分析是项目技术管理流程的起点。在这一步中,项目经理和技术团队需要与客户进行深入的交流,了解客户的业务需求,明确项目的目标和范围。同时,也需要对市场和竞品进行分析,确保项目的竞争力。需求分析的结果将直接影响到后续的系统设计和编码实现。
二、系统设计
在需求分析的基础上,项目团队将开始进行系统设计。系统设计是将需求转化为具体的系统结构和模块的过程。在这一步中,项目团队需要根据需求分析的结果,制定出系统的架构、模块划分、接口设计等技术方案,并进行详细的设计文档编写。
三、编码实现
编码实现是项目技术管理流程中的实践阶段。在这一步中,开发团队需要根据系统设计的结果,使用编程语言进行代码编写。编码实现的质量直接影响到系统的性能和稳定性。因此,开发团队需要严格遵守编码规范,确保代码的质量。
四、系统测试
系统测试是项目技术管理流程中的验证阶段。在这一步中,测试团队需要对系统进行全面的测试,包括功能测试、性能测试、安全测试等,确保系统满足需求分析中确定的需求,并达到预定的性能目标。
五、系统维护
系统上线后,项目团队还需要对系统进行持续的维护和优化。系统维护包括修复系统中出现的问题、优化系统性能、更新系统功能等。同时,项目团队还需要对用户反馈进行处理,根据用户的使用情况对系统进行持续的优化和改进。
以上就是项目技术管理流程的全过程。在这个过程中,项目经理和技术团队需要紧密合作,确保项目的顺利进行。同时,也需要使用到许多项目管理工具,比如PingCode和Worktile,来辅助项目的管理和协作。
相关问答FAQs:
1. 项目技术管理流程的概述是什么?
项目技术管理流程是指在项目实施过程中,对技术方面的管理和控制,以确保项目按时、按质、按量完成。它包括项目的技术规划、技术需求分析、技术方案设计、技术实施和技术评估等多个环节。
2. 项目技术管理流程的具体内容有哪些?
项目技术管理流程的具体内容可以分为以下几个方面:
- 技术规划:在项目启动阶段,制定项目的技术目标、技术策略和技术计划,明确项目的技术方向和重点。
- 技术需求分析:根据项目的需求和目标,对技术需求进行详细分析和定义,明确项目的技术要求和技术标准。
- 技术方案设计:根据技术需求和项目的实际情况,制定项目的技术方案,包括技术架构设计、系统设计和接口设计等。
- 技术实施:根据技术方案,组织开发团队进行系统的编码和开发工作,确保项目按照技术方案的要求进行实施。
- 技术评估:在项目实施过程中,对技术实施的效果进行评估和监控,及时发现和解决技术问题,确保项目的技术质量和进度。
- 技术交付:项目完成后,按照技术交付的要求,将项目的技术成果交付给用户或相关方,确保项目的技术成果得到有效利用。
3. 项目技术管理流程的重要性是什么?
项目技术管理流程的重要性主要体现在以下几个方面:
- 提高项目的技术质量:通过科学的技术管理流程,能够确保项目按照规定的技术标准和要求进行实施,提高项目的技术质量和可靠性。
- 提高项目的进度控制:通过技术管理流程,能够对项目的技术实施进行有效的控制和监督,及时发现和解决技术问题,确保项目按时完成。
- 降低项目的风险:通过技术管理流程,能够对项目的技术风险进行评估和控制,减少项目的技术风险,提高项目的成功率。
- 提高项目的成本控制:通过技术管理流程,能够对项目的技术资源进行合理的调配和利用,提高项目的成本效益。
综上所述,项目技术管理流程对于项目的成功实施具有重要的作用,能够提高项目的技术质量、进度控制、降低风险和成本控制。
文章标题:项目技术管理流程有哪些内容,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3085950